Transaction 8b56bf0d4617e3cbea34bb88cb2c8ea6069f1151e02bae30cd8bed799cd23bde
1 Input
1 Output
-
8b56bf0d4617e3cbea34bb88cb2c8ea6069f1151e02bae30cd8bed799cd23bde:0
- value
- 20696606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 61e3169d8db70e92bd67e1d816ac2a6c09bd2975 OP_EQUAL
- address
- 3AcbWXTMFieJofFT9rNH8cLjk7FVKdhoEg